Discuss the thought process of the owners of a new business with regard to property taxes when deciding where to locate. Will they always locate where property taxes are lowest? Why or why not?

Answer to Question 1

When deciding where to locate a new business, business owners typically have their choice of several sites and thus can choose among various locations. While high property taxes create a disincentive to improve upon property, property taxes are used to provide government services. Thus businesses are concerned with whether the property tax covers the value of the services the business will receive from government. In other words, they will not always locate where property taxes are the lowest. They will locate in communities that have the optimal mix of public sector output at the right property tax price.

According to the Migraine Research Foundation, migraines are the third most prevalent illness in the world. Women are most affected (18%), followed by children of both sexes (10%), and men (6%).

Nearly all drugs pass into human breast milk. How often a drug is taken influences the amount of drug that will pass into the milk. Medications taken 30 to 60 minutes before breastfeeding are likely to be at peak blood levels when the baby is nursing.

About 80% of major fungal systemic infections are due to Candida albicans. Another form, Candida peritonitis, occurs most often in postoperative patients. A rare disease, Candida meningitis, may follow leukemia, kidney transplant, other immunosuppressed factors, or when suffering from Candida septicemia.
